About Jane Case‐Smith
Jane Case‐Smith is a scholar working on Psychiatry and Mental health, Clinical Psychology, Occupational Therapy, Developmental and Educational Psychology and Education, having authored 89 papers that have together received 3.3k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Cerebral Palsy and Movement Disorders (21 papers), Occupational Therapy Practice and Research (18 papers), Family and Disability Support Research (17 papers), Infant Development and Preterm Care (14 papers), Writing and Handwriting Education (12 papers), Child Nutrition and Feeding Issues (10 papers), Autism Spectrum Disorder Research (10 papers) and Children's Physical and Motor Development (10 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Occupational Therapy (470 citations), Psychiatry and Mental health (1.1k citations), Developmental and Educational Psychology (848 citations), Cognitive Neuroscience (737 citations) and Clinical Psychology (727 citations). Jane Case‐Smith has collaborated with scholars based in United States and Australia. Frequent co-authors include Lindy Weaver, Marian Arbesman, Mary A. Fristad, Deborah S. Nichols, Teresa A. Bryan, Heather Miller, Carol A. Powell, Stephanie DeLuca, Richard D. Stevenson and Sharon Landesman Ramey. Their work appears in journals such as American Journal of Occupational Therapy, Physical & Occupational Therapy In Pediatrics, OTJR Occupational Therapy Journal of Research, Pediatric Physical Therapy and Archives of Physical Medicine and Rehabilitation.
